It was a quiet day in Moremi.
The Xakanaxa pride has not been seen since last week Wednesday and I have not seen any sign of them or the buffalo over the last two days. Tomorrow will be dedicated to locating them.
I’m familiar with the herd of elephants we spent the morning with. The matriarch is not the most subdued and has charged the vehicle in the past.





We kept our distance and the herd became relaxed enough in our presence that they moved into the shade of a Mopane and went to sleep.
The adults slept standing while the calves and teenagers lay down. There was one calf which was restless and it kept climbing on and over its siblings. Eventually it found a comfortable spot and the entire herd was asleep. They slept for over and hour, some of the younger elephants needed a push and a prod to get them up. They then moved off across the floodplain to the nearest water.
